Everything You Need To Know About Insulator Products

When it comes to electricity and keeping it safe and well-insulated, insulator products are essential. These products play a crucial role in ensuring that electrical currents are contained within wires and cables, preventing them from leaking out and causing a range of hazards such as electric shocks, short circuits, and fires. In this article, we will explore the different types of insulator products available, their uses, and why they are so important in various industries.

insulator products are materials that have high resistance to the flow of electrical current. They are typically used to separate conductors carrying electrical current and to support those conductors in their proper position. Insulators come in various forms, including glass, ceramic, plastic, and rubber materials. The choice of insulator material depends on the specific application and the environment in which the insulator will be used.

One common type of insulator product is the glass insulator. Glass insulators are commonly used in overhead power lines to support and separate electrical conductors. These insulators are made from toughened glass that is capable of withstanding high temperatures and harsh weather conditions. Glass insulators have been used for many years in the electrical industry and are known for their durability and reliability.

Ceramic insulators are another popular type of insulator product. These insulators are made from ceramic materials that have high electrical resistance and excellent heat resistance properties. Ceramic insulators are commonly used in high-voltage applications where extreme heat and electrical stress are present. They are also used in industries such as the automotive, aerospace, and telecommunications sectors.

Plastic insulators are lightweight and flexible insulator products that are commonly used in low-voltage applications. These insulators are made from various plastic materials such as PVC, nylon, and polyethylene. Plastic insulators are cost-effective and easy to install, making them ideal for a wide range of electrical applications. However, plastic insulators are less durable than glass or ceramic insulators and may degrade over time when exposed to harsh environmental conditions.

Rubber insulators are another type of insulator product that is commonly used in electrical applications. Rubber insulators are made from synthetic rubber materials that have excellent electrical and thermal insulation properties. These insulators are often used in outdoor installations where they need to withstand exposure to sunlight, humidity, and temperature changes. Rubber insulators are also used in high-voltage applications where flexibility and resilience are required.
